Job Overview

The Supply Chain Manager will lead the end‑to‑end logistics network for Syngenta Egypt, overseeing procurement, inventory management, distribution, and demand planning for agricultural inputs such as seeds, fertilizers, and crop protection chemicals. This role is pivotal in aligning supply chain operations with the company’s sustainability goals, ensuring product availability while minimizing waste and carbon footprint. The successful candidate will collaborate with cross‑functional teams, including sales, production, finance, and external partners, to optimize processes and drive continuous improvement.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ute strategic supply chain plans that support regional sales targets and seasonal demand fluctuations.
  • Manage relationships with key suppliers, negotiate contracts, and ensure compliance with quality and regulatory standards.
  • Oversee inventory levels across multiple warehouses in Aswan, Luxor, and Cairo, implementing just‑in‑time practices to reduce holding costs.
  • Coordinate transportation and distribution activities, selecting optimal routes and carriers to guarantee on‑time delivery.
  • Lead demand forecasting initiatives using advanced analytics and historical sales data.
  • Implement sustainability initiatives, such as carbon‑offset logistics and waste reduction programs.
  •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) and generate regular reports for senior leadership.
  • Ensure adherence to health, safety, and environmental regulations throughout the supply chain.
